Relative Search:
Baidu Google
Edit this listing

Aqua Clean Technologies Inc

10236 NW 47th St
Sunrise , FL 33351
954-578-4940
Category

Driving Directions

From:
To: 10236 NW 47th St ,Sunrise , FL 33351